one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the web wherein a protracted URL might be converted into a shorter, far more workable sort. This shortened URL redirects to the original extensive URL when visited.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-acknowledged samples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social media platforms like Twitter, the place character limits for posts produced it challenging to share very long URLs.

2. Main Factors of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ener typically is made of the following components:

Website Interface: This is the entrance-end part wherever users can enter their very long URLs and get shortened variations. It might be a straightforward type with a Website.
Database: A database is critical to store the mapping among the initial prolonged URL and also the shortened Variation.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L possibilities like MongoDB may be used.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that will take the brief URL and redirects the user for the corresponding extended URL. This logic is often carried out in the world wide web server or an application layer.
API: A lot of URL shorteners present an API in order that third-get together pur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first extensive URLs.
three.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a lengthy URL into a brief one particular. Many procedures is often utilized, like:

Hashing: The long URL may be hashed into a set-size string, which serves since the shorter URL. Even so, hash collisions (various URLs leading to a similar h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A single frequent technique is to employ Base62 encoding (which utilizes 62 figures: 0-nine, A-Z, plus a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ds on the entry during the database. This process makes certain that the shorter URL is as small as feasible.
Random String Generation: Yet another tactic is to make a random string of a hard and fast length (e.g., 6 figures) and Check out if it’s presently in use while in the databases. If not, it’s assigned to your long URL.
four. Database Management
The database schema for the URL shortener will likely be clear-cut, with two Major fields:

ID: A unique identifier for every URL entry.
Extensive URL: The initial URL that should be shortened.
Brief URL/Slug: The shorter Edition of your URL, usually saved as a unique string.
Together with these, you might want to retail outlet metadata such as the generation date, expiration date, and the volume of occasions the limited URL has long been accessed.

5. Handling Redirection
Redirection is often a significant A part of the URL shortener's operation. Every time a user clicks on a short URL, the support must swiftly retrieve the initial URL within the databases and redirect the person utilizing an HTTP 301 (everlasting red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) position code.

Overall performance is essential listed here, as the procedure need to be virtually instantaneous. Techniques like databases indexing and caching (e.g., using Redis or Memcached) might be used to speed up the retrieval course of action.

6. Safety Criteria
Safety is a big concern in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ute malicious backlinks.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-celebration protection products and services to examine URLs before shortening them can mitigate this threat.
Spam Prevention: Amount restricting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ers wanting to make Many brief URLs.
7. Scalability
Because the URL shortener grows, it may have to manage a lot of UR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, maybe invol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ute traffic throughout multiple servers to handle high h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inctive expert services to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ners usually offer analytics to track how frequently a brief URL is clicked, in which the visitors is coming from, as well as other useful metrics. This necessitates logging Just about every red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
